L3Harris Unveils Dedicated Missile Solutions Company Backed by $1 Billion DoW Investment
Strategic Partnering: DoW Backs L3Harris’ Missile Solutions Spin-Off with Major Capital Injection
L3Harris announced the launch of a new Missile Solutions business, supported by an unprecedented $1 billion investment from the Department of War (DoW). This deal is structured around the DoW acquiring a convertible preferred security, which will transform into common equity upon an anticipated initial public offering (IPO) of the business in the second half of 2026. The move aims to rapidly scale production capacity for vital missile propulsion systems, addressing rising demand propelled by national defense priorities.
IPO and Growth Focus: New Company Targets Unmatched Speed and Scale
The planned IPO will see L3Harris’ Missile Solutions company stand as a pure-play propulsion leader, delivering systems for high-profile U.S. and allied missile programs like PAC-3, THAAD, Tomahawk, and the Standard Missile. L3Harris will retain a controlling interest in the new entity, sharpening its strategic focus while potentially unlocking substantial value for shareholders and stakeholders in the defense sector.
Market Implications: Transforming the U.S. Defense Propulsion Landscape
This step marks a significant transformation for L3Harris, leveraging its 2023 acquisition of Aerojet Rocketdyne and a period of operational investment to position itself at the core of offensive and defensive missile supply chains. By consolidating its missile technology assets and drawing direct backing from the federal government, the new company could become a pivotal partner as the DoW shifts procurement towards greater agility and capacity.
